litermi / raw-query
响应是一个运行原始查询的包。
1.0.27
2024-05-08 18:33 UTC
Requires
- php: ^7.4|^8.0
- guzzlehttp/guzzle: ^6.3.1|^7.0.1
- illuminate/config: ^7.20|^8.19|^9.0|^10.0|^11.0
- illuminate/contracts: ^7.20|^8.19|^9.0|^10.0|^11.0
- illuminate/database: ^7.20|^8.19|^9.0|^10.0|^11.0
- illuminate/http: ^7.20|^8.19|^9.0|^10.0|^11.0
- litermi/cache-query-builder: ^1.0
- litermi/error-notification: ^1.0
- litermi/logs: ^1.0
README
关于
原始查询
是一个包,用于作为第一步将旧代码从纯 PHP 迁移到 PHP。
如何创建 composer 包的教程
安装
在您的 composer.json
中要求 litermi/raw-query
包并更新您的依赖项。
composer require litermi/raw-query
配置
在 app.php 中设置提供者和别名。
'providers' => [ // ... Litermi\RawQuery\Providers\ServiceProvider::class, ], 'aliases' => [ 'RawQuery' => Litermi\RawQuery\Facades\RawQuery::class ]
默认设置在 config/raw-query.php
中。发布配置以将文件复制到您自己的配置文件。
php artisan vendor:publish --provider="Litermi\RawQuery\Providers\ServiceProvider"
注意:这是必须的,以便您可以更改默认配置。
用法
use Litermi\RawQuery\Facades\RawQuery; $product = RawQuery::to('mysql')->getRow("select * from products where id_product=".$idProduct);
许可证
在 MIT 许可证下发布,请参阅 LICENSE。